Handover note — weekly cash-box run

Tomas, taking over from me for Friday's cash-box run to the Dellport counting office. The box is in locker 4, already sealed and logged. Keep it in the cab, not the load bed, and go straight there — no other stops on that leg. Sign-out sheet is on the clipboard by the dock door. For the hand-over itself, follow the confidential instruction below.

dispatch memo: the eliok quenok courier leaves the sorael aldath belion tammir casix gileth queniel jorath ledger at gate 9299 under passcode 897989

Ticket: Staging env misconfigured for Siftgate bloom filter

The bloom layer in front of the Pellet KV store is rejecting all lookups in staging because the env file was copied from the dev template without credentials. False-positive tuning values are fine; only the auth line is missing. To unblock the weekly demo, the Pellet admission secret must be set on the following line.

env line for yaguf-fajop: LEDGER_TOKEN13=fb08984397349

Subject: Eventforge Schema Registry — new build rolling out

Hi all,

The Eventforge schema registry now validates every event payload against its registered version before fan-out. New team members: you don't need to register schemas manually anymore; the publish pipeline does it on merge. Backward-incompatible changes will be rejected at CI, not at runtime, so expect earlier failures and fewer surprises in production. Rollout to the Harlowe cluster starts tomorrow morning. For verification, the build token for this release is below.

session token of tajef-bageg = htk21_5d90d574934f3ccae6437